POPULAR WEDDING PRESENTS

 

Classic wedding presents with design and decoration for the home are always popular and well-appreciated. These kinds of beautiful pieces are the sort of thing people might splurge on for themselves, so they’re certain to be delighted to receive them as presents. Elegant items given as wedding presents include high-quality bed sheets, wonderfully soft and fluffy towels, a pair of cosy dressing gowns or a fancy soap and hand cream set. Other more classic wedding presents include stylish candlesticks, beautiful crockery, good cookware or wine glasses that you could even have the couple’s initials engraved into. Glassware, posters, prints and design classics that will bring the couple joy for years to come are also perfect gifts for a wedding. 

PERSONAL WEDDING PRESENTS

 

Would you rather give something more personal, something the couple could do together and that might symbolise how to nurture their love for one another so it blossoms? If that’s the case, plants are the perfect gift. For example, an acorn that you grow in an elegant glass vase or a beautiful tree, such as a lemon tree or fig bush, planted in a stylish pot. If you know the couple well, you might have collected a range of wonderful photos of them. Print them out and frame them to help the couple create a beautiful wall of photos in their home. Are the couple avid travellers? If so, a weekend bag could be a practical and personal gift for them. Or perhaps a pair of matching sandals and sun hats that they could use on their honeymoon! Are the couple keen gym-goers? They might love the gift of a pair of nice yoga mats. Are they attached to their phones? Perhaps matching phone cases engraved with their wedding date would be just the thing?

HOMEMADE WEDDING PRESENTS

 

This is a wonderfully personal, thoughtful and heartfelt option for crafty types. Make your own wedding present! You could bake some little biscotti and put them in a fancy jar, brew some homemade kombucha tea and fill some glass jars, or nurture a sourdough starter that the couple can use to bake their own bread. Rustle up your own elderflower cordial, pickle onions and other vegetables, or bake a delicious seeded crispbread to present in a nice box. Homemade presents are always exciting and unique, making them even more fun to give and make.
